Delphi Studio » Примеры на Delphi » Примеры на Delphi Система » Работа с INI-файлами. Пример на Delphi
Показать все теги


Данный пример будет сохранять в INI-файл config.ini все записи со всех Edit и не важно сколько их у вас будет. В uses добавить IniFiles
Загружаем INI-файл config.ini при запуске программы
var
ini : TiniFile;
I : Integer;
begin
ini := TIniFile.Create(ExtractFilePath(Application.ExeName)+'config.ini');
try
for I := 0 to ComponentCount - 1 do
begin
if (Components[i] is TEdit) then
(Components[i] as TEdit).Text := ini.ReadString(Components[i].ClassName, Components[i].Name, '');
end;
finally
ini.Free;
end;
end;
Сохраняем в INI-файл config.ini всё что находится во всех Edit на форме при закрытии программы
var
ini : TiniFile;
i : integer;
begin
ini := TiniFile.Create(ExtractFilePath(Application.ExeName)+'config.ini');
try
for I := 0 to ComponentCount - 1 do
if Components[i] is TEdit then
ini.WriteString(Components[i].ClassName, Components[i].Name, (Components[i] as TEdit).Text);
finally
ini.Free;
end;
end;
Есть ещё пример для работы с INI-файлами но в отличии от предыдущего примера, этот будет сохранять только конкретный компонент. В uses добавить IniFiles
...
procedure OpenIniFile;
procedure SaveIniFile;
var
Ini : TIniFile;
begin
Ini := TiniFile.Create(extractfilepath(Application.ExeName)+'settings.ini');
Edit1.Text := Ini.ReadString('Main','Edit1',Edit1.Text);
Ini.Free;
end;
procedure TForm1.FormCreate(Sender: TObject);
begin
OpenIniFile;
end;
procedure TForm1.SaveIniFile;
var
Ini : TIniFile;
begin
Ini := TiniFile.Create(extractfilepath(Application.ExeName)+'settings.ini');
Ini.WriteString('Main','Edit1',Edit1.Text);
Ini.Free;
end;
procedure TForm1.FormClose(Sender: TObject; var Action: TCloseAction);
begin
SaveIniFile;
end;

Посетители, находящиеся в группе Гости, не могут оставлять комментарии в данной новости.
Лучшее на Delphi Studio
Лучшие книги по Delphi
-
Книга Delphi 2010 Handbook with Source Code - Книга Delphi 2010 Handbook with Source Code посвящена CodeGear Delphi 2010
Книга Программирование в Delphi глазами хакера. Фленов - В книге вы найдете множество нестандартных приемов программирования на языке Delphi, его недокументированные функции и возможности. Вы узнаете, как создавать маленькие шуточные программы. Большая часть книги посвящена программированию сетей
Книга Delphi в шутку и всерьез что умеют хакеры М.Флёнов - Электронная книга о профессиональных приемах программирования в Delphi. В легкой и доступной форме с использованием большого количества профессиональных примеров рассмотрены вопросы корректного написания кода, оптимизации программ, работы с системным окружением, создания сетевых приложений
Книга Библия Delphi Михаил Фленов (2-е издание) + CD - Книга посвящена программированию на языке Delphi от самых основ до примеров построения конкретных приложений. Подробно описывается логика выполнения каждого участка кода, чтобы читатель смог использовать эти знания при решении собственных задач. Книга содержит большое количество примеров практического программирования
Книга О чем не пишут в книгах по Delphi + CD Григорьев А.Б - Рассмотрены малоосвещенные вопросы программирования в Delphi. Описаны методы интеграции VCL и API. Показаны внутренние механизмы VCL и приведены примеры вмешательства в эти механизмы. Рассмотрено использование сокетов в Delphi: различные режимы их работы, особенности для протоколов TCP и UDP
Книга Delphi 7 Учебный курс С.Бобровский - Электронная книга является руководством по программированию в среде Delplii 7. Описывается весь процесс разработки программы: от конструирования диалогового окна до организации справочной системы и создания установочного CD-ROM
Книга Delphi Быстрый Старт - В книге описываются интерфейс системы визуального программирования Delphi на основе 6-й версии, состав и характеристика элементов проекта приложения, приемы программирования на языке Object Pascal
Книга Indy in Depth. Глубины Indy - Книга Indy in Depth Глубины Indy будет интересно для тех, кто интересуется хакингом, вирусописанием, а значит и для тех, кто занимается защитой сетей, программ, информации. Эта книга не только по Indy, она про Интернет, про протоколы, термины, методы работы, а к Indy относятся только примеры
Книга OpenGL - Графика в проектах Delphi + CD. М.В.Краснов - Книга посвящена использованию стандартной графической библиотеки OpenGL в проектах Delphi. Начиная с самой минимальной программы, последовательно и подробно рассматриваются все основные принципы программирования компьютерной графики: двухмерные итрехмерные построения, анимация, работа с текстурой, визуальные эффекты
Книга Delphi 7 для профессионалов. Марко Кэнту - Книга, которую должен прочитать каждый, кто хочет стать профессиональным программистом на Delphi. Книга не предназначена для начинающих. Требуются хорошие знания Delphi. Предназначена для тех, кто хочет стать именно профессиональным программистом
- Delphi Studio Примеры на Delphi Примеры на Delphi [Сеть Интернет] Примеры на Delphi [Система] Примеры на Delphi [Графика Мультимедиа] Примеры на Delphi [Базы данных] Delphi Исходники Исходники Delphi [Сеть Интернет] Исходники Delphi [Система] Исходники Delphi [Графика Мультимедиа] Delphi Исходники [Базы данных] Компоненты Delphi Скачать Компоненты Delphi Скачать Delphi / Pascal Скачать Книги, Учебники Delphi Скачать Книги, Учебники Pascal Delphi Статьи Pascal Статьи Вопросы и ответы по Delphi Вопросы и ответы по Pascal Карта сайта Delphi Studio Канал RSS Delphi Studio
mouse_event в c++
скриншот по сети делфи
cooltrayicon delphi 7
как свернуть в трей visual studio 2008
showmessage delphi
текстовый редактор исходники Delphi
добавить программу в авто загрузку на delphi
проверка текста delphi
дельфи для чайников
печать в Opengl,дельфи
скрыть форму на панели пуск в delphi 7
delphi статьи
открытие "cd rom" OR cdrom windows
вконтакте delphi
для чайников или для новичков как программно перезагруить компьютер delphi
самоучитель delphi скачать
исходник передачи скриншота делфи
Delphi как закрыть программу по горячей клавише
delphi DateToStr
извлечение файлов delphi
0h
проверить есть ли файл delphi
библия delphi 2-е издание купить
компонент из формы
авторизация mail.ru idhttp;
известные программы написанные на delphi
idftp delphi
if opendialog execute
как программно поменять BorderStyle у Form
richedit editor example delphi
исходник авторизация на mail.ru
turbo pascal 7.0 УЧЕБНОЕ ПОСОБИЕ
исходники вконтакте
delphi матрица исходник
скачать библиотеку openGL для delphi 7
Turbo Pascal в задачах и примерах
как время преоброзовать в вещественное число в delphi
Сайт Delphi Studio рассчитан для начинающих, новичков, чайников, которые решили программировать на Delphi :)
Добавляйте свои примеры, исходники, компоненты, статьи и тогда на сайте будет много полезной информации, что поможет друг другу находить нужный материал.
Как не дать открыть Диспетчер задач Windows Пример на Delphi - Пример на Delphi показывающий как не дать открыть Диспетчер задач Windows. На форму нужно кинуть компонент Timer
Функции для работы со строками в Delphi + примеры - Функции для работы со строками в Delphi + примеры (Pos, Copy, ReverseString, Insert, Delete, SetLength, IntToStr, StrToInt, FloatToStr, StrToFloat, DateToStr, TimeToStr, StrToDate, StrToTime, LowerCase, UpperCase, Trim, TrimLeft, TrimRight)
Как открыть и закрыть CD-ROM в Windows (MMSystem). Пример на Delphi - Пример на Delphi показывающий как можно открыть и закрыть CD-ROM в Windows. В uses нужно дабвить MMSystem
А знаете ли вы что такие известные программы как AIMP, Skype, QIP, QIP Infium, R&Q, The Bat!, FL Studio, Guitar Pro, Game Maker, Total Commander, PowerArchiver, Download Master написаны на Delphi? И это далеко не весь список программ чем может похвастаться продукция Borland Delphi!